The Core Mechanics that Keep the Beat Pumping

The flow of AviaMasters is deliberately streamlined to keep players engaged:

  • Betting Phase: Set your stake and speed—this is your only decision point.
  • Flight Phase: Hit “Play” and watch the aircraft ascend automatically.
  • Collection Phase: Multipliers and rockets appear on screen; your counter balance updates instantly.
  • Landing Phase: The aircraft either lands on a carrier (win) or crashes into water (loss).

The flight’s duration is dictated by your speed choice—Turbo will finish faster but may expose you to more rockets; Slow will take longer but offers slightly steadier odds.

Because each round ends quickly, players often experience a rapid-fire cycle of betting, watching multipliers climb, and seeing whether they land successfully—all within seconds. This quick turnaround is what keeps the energy high for those who favor short sessions.

Multipliers and Rockets: The Flashy Gamble

Multipliers are the heartbeats of AviaMasters—every time one appears, your counter balance climbs.

  • Additive multipliers (+1/+2/+5/+10): These give gradual boosts and are common during early flight stages.
  • X‑type multipliers (x2/x3/x4/x5): Each is more valuable and appears less frequently but can catapult your winnings significantly.

The rockets are the game’s built‑in tension device:

  • A rocket appears unpredictably and halves your current counter balance while lowering your aircraft’s trajectory.
  • Rockets are more likely at higher speeds because the flight time is shorter but risk spikes due to more aggressive multiplier distribution.
